Hogyan lehet fájlokat átvinni Android telefonok és táblagépek között MTP-vel az Ubuntuban



Próbálja Ki A Műszerünket A Problémák Kiküszöbölésére

A Google Androidot, sőt az újabb Android x86 és Android x86_64 platformokat használó eszközök ugyanazon a rendszermagon alapulnak, mint az Ubuntu. Mindkettő a GNU / Linux operációs rendszer megvalósítása, és a közöttük lévő fájlátvitel általában nagyon egyszerű. Ha USB-kábelt csatlakoztathat telefonjáról vagy táblagépéről egyenesen az Ubuntu PC-hez, akkor általában nem okoz gondot fájlok küldésével. Ez még azokon a Macintosh gépeken is működik, amelyekhez telepítette az Ubuntut, függetlenül attól, hogy kettős rendszerindítással rendelkeznek-e vagy sem.



A dolgok egy kicsit bonyolultabbak, ha fájlkezelő helyett Media Transfer Protocol alkalmazást akarunk használni, mivel az MTP és az Ubuntu nem feltétlenül kedveli egymást. Szerencsére van rá mód, hogy elérje őket, hogy ugyanazokkal a fájlrendszer-könyvtárakkal kommunikáljanak, hogy könnyedén továbbítsák a fájlokat oda-vissza bármely Android-eszközükre. Ennek működnie kell az Ubuntu bármely modern, hivatalos verziójával, beleértve azokat is, amelyek alternatív grafikus fájlkezelőket használnak. Ha Xubuntut használ a Thunarral, a Lubuntut a PCManFM-mel vagy a Kubuntut a Dolphinnal, akkor továbbra sem lesz probléma, bár a megfelelő MTP-eszközökkel kell fájlokat küldenie, ha nincs megfelelő pluginja.



Az MTP telepítése és használata az Ubuntuban

Mielőtt fájlok küldésére és fogadására használja, több közös MTP (Media Transfer Protocol) alkalmazást kell telepítenie. Ezt megteheti a Synaptic Package Manager segítségével, ha elérhető a Dash, a Whisker Menu vagy az LX panelen. Meg kell keresnie és telepítenie kell ezeket a csomagokat:



libmtp-common

mtp-tools

libmtp-dev



libmtp-futásidejű

libmtp9

A Synaptic több mint valószínű, hogy telepítés közben elkezdi javasolni némelyiket függőségként, így nem kell mindegyiket egyenként megtalálni. Mindig elkezdheti beírni egy csomag nevét, hogy megtalálja azt a hosszú listában, amelyet a Synaptic ad a program indításakor. Természetesen a csomagok telepítéséhez root jogosultságokra lesz szükség, ezért valószínűleg meg kell adnia a jelszavát az indításkor.

Könnyebb módszer a terminál megnyitása a CTRL, az ALT és a T lenyomásával, majd a következő parancsok kiadásával:

sudo apt-get frissítés

sudo apt-get install libmtp-common mtp-eszközök libmtp-dev libmtp-futásidejű libmtp9

sudo apt-get dist-upgrade

Mindkét esetben telepítenie kell a protokoll használatához szükséges eszközöket. A FUSE (Filesystem in Userspace) ellenőrzi a felhasználók által a jogosultságok nélkül végrehajtott fájlrendszer-telepítési szerelvényeket, ezért csak korlátlan hozzáférést engedélyez a root-fiókhoz, amelyet alapértelmezés szerint kivonatolnak az Ubuntuban. Egy adott fájl szerkesztésével felülírhatja a FUSE beépített biztonsági szolgáltatásait. típus a terminálnál, és nyomja meg az Enter billentyűt.

A fájl alján talál egy sort, amely a következőt írja: #user_allow_other, és el kell távolítania a kivonatjelet a sor elejéről. Minden más sort kommentálva kell hagyni. Nyomja meg egyszerre a CTRL és az X gombot, nyomja meg az y gombot, majd nyomja meg az Enter billentyűt. Ez elmenti a fájlt.

Csatlakoztassa készülékét a számítógéphez az USB-kábellel, majd írja be az lsusb billentyűt egy asztal előhozásához. Keresse meg készülékének nevét a táblázatban. Nyugodtan figyelmen kívül hagyhatja a program által közölt egyéb információkat, és ha hiányzik a név, akkor biztonságosan futtathatja, ahányszor csak akarja.

Miután megtalálta az eszközt azonosító sort, futtassa és nyomja meg az Enter billentyűt. Cserélheti a nano-t egy másik terminálszöveg-szerkesztő nevére, ha inkább a nano helyett használna egyet, például vi vagy akár emacs, ha úgy tetszik. A fájl alján adja hozzá a kódsorot:

Cserélje a nameOfDevice nevet annak az eszköznek a nevére, amelyet az lsusb futtatása után talált, és a négy számjelet fel kell cserélni az első és második négyjegyű címkészlettel, amely közvetlenül a név után található. Gyakorlatilag a # szimbólum utáni szöveg egy megjegyzett címke, és utána bármit beírhat, amit szeretne, így ha meg kell jegyeznie a készülékével kapcsolatos információkat, akkor ez megfelelő hely erre.

Miután elmentette a fájlt, biztonságosan távolítsa el és távolítsa el az összes USB-eszközt, amely jelenleg a rendszerhez csatlakozik, és futtassa a sudo service udev restart alkalmazást a terminál ablakából. Mentse el a fennmaradó munkát, amelyet megnyit, és bezár minden programot, mielőtt teljesen újraindítja a gépet.

Amint a számítógép újraindul, dugja vissza Android telefonját vagy táblagépét, miután megbizonyosodott arról, hogy nem zárta le a képernyőt. Mostantól képesnek kell lennie arra, hogy a gyorsabb MTP könyvtárak segítségével fájlokat továbbítson Android-eszközére és onnan. Bármikor futtassa a szinkronizálási parancsot argumentumok nélkül a terminálról, ha meg akarja győződni arról, hogy az Ubuntu által az adatok ideiglenes tárolásához használt pufferek teljesen ki vannak-e írva Android-eszközére. Ez biztosítja, hogy semmilyen adatvesztést ne szenvedjen.

Ha van egy microSDHC foglalat az eszközön, akkor az Ubuntu akár vfat fájlrendszerként is csatlakoztathatja, ami megzavarja egyes felhasználókat. Ez valójában nem kapcsolódik az MTP-hez, és ennek akkor is meg kell történnie, ha még nincs telepítve az MTP. Míg a vfat a virtuális fájlkiosztási táblázatot jelenti, semmi sem virtualizált vagy utánzott. Ez egy szabványos FAT12, FAT16 vagy FAT32 fájlrendszer, amely megosztja örökségét a régi MS-DOS fájlkezelési módszerrel. A Microsoft Windows egy úgynevezett virtuális eszköz-illesztőprogram segítségével lehetővé tette, hogy hosszú fájlneveket írjon ezekhez a fájlrendszerekhez, amikor a DOS nem engedélyezi, és az Android ugyanezt a struktúrát használja a csatolt SD-kártyák csatlakoztatásához.

Ha van ilyen kártyája, akkor gond nélkül másolhat és áthelyezhet fájlokat az Ubuntu és az Ubuntu között, bár nem támogatja a Unix fájlengedélyeket. Ügyeljen arra, hogy az adatvesztés megakadályozása érdekében külön USB-eszközként adja ki.

4 perc olvasás